bcco1239 wrote:
> Installed as upgrade.
Then you reformat your drive, then use the XP backup image you made
before installing Vista to restore XP, or you unplug the HDD you
installed Vista on and plug your original XP HDD back in.
Sorry but it is not possible to undo Vista without reformatting and
re-installing XP, says so on the tin and in numerous posts throughout
this NG, the Windows Vista Download site does say
"DO NOT INSTALL ON A PRODUCTION PC"
Hope you made backups.
